Question of the Week: Third Class Medicals and Recreational Flying

EAA and AOPA will propose to the FAA that the driver's license medical that now applies to Sport Pilot certificate holders be expanded, and their initial suggestion is that it be limited to the ability to fly four-place aircraft (with one passenger) having 180 horsepower or less, fixed gear, day VFR.
